The project titled "Implementing a Social Enterprise Model for Sustainable Impact: A Case Study Analysis" aims to explore the practical implementation of a social enterprise model to achieve sustainable impact in a specific context. Social enterprises have emerged as a unique approach to addressing social and environmental issues while ensuring financial sustainability. This research seeks to investigate how a social enterprise model can be effectively designed, implemented, and managed to create lasting positive outcomes for both the community and the organization.
